This is a Validated Antibody Database (VAD) review about human KRT16, based on 92 published articles (read how Labome selects the articles), using KRT16 antibody in all methods. It is aimed to help Labome visitors find the most suited KRT16 antibody. Please note the number of articles fluctuates since newly identified citations are added and citations for discontinued catalog numbers are removed regularly.
KRT16 synonym: CK16; FNEPPK; K16; K1CP; KRT16A; NEPPK; PC1
